Description Keploy is an innovative open-source developer tool designed to automate the generation of test cases and data stubs (mocks) directly from real user traffic. It significantly simplifies end-to-end testing across various components like APIs, databases, and third-party services, regardless of the underlying tech stack. By capturing network interactions and transforming them into executable tests and reliable mocks, Keploy drastically reduces the manual effort and time typically required for writing and maintaining comprehensive test suites, thereby enhancing code reliability and accelerating development cycles. What It Does Keploy operates by recording API calls and network interactions as user traffic flows through an application. From these recordings, it automatically generates executable test cases and corresponding data mocks for all external dependencies. Developers can then replay these generated tests locally or integrate them into CI/CD pipelines to ensure consistent application behavior and catch regressions early, all without requiring any changes to the application's source code.
